In a seven-hour interview in Klan Kosova, Citaku has said it is a heavy burden to be an ambassador of a small country a big country like America.
We have an extremely active and successful Albanian community. Even Albanians have given their lives when war has happened. We have the case of the Bytyqi brothers who came from America to fight in Kosovo”.
Citaku has stressed that Albanians in America hold important positions.
We have 6 Albanians winning in the local elections alone. We need to maintain this friendship over and over again. Our freedom and independence is the product of our resistance but it would be difficult to achieve without friends. We were lucky to be in great reality with the U.S., but this relationship should be cultivated”.
